Club of Ca Trù Thang Long is a voluntary, non-profit group of Ca Trù musicians founded in 2006 in Hanoi. It has about 15 members, most of them aged between 10 and early-30s. This club was set up by two elderly master-musicians, Nguyen Thi Chuc and Nguyen Phu De, with Pham Thi Hue, who is teacher of traditional Vietnamese music at the National Academy of Music in Hanoi. Ca Trù Thang Long has grown to be one of the most active of Ca Trù clubs in north Vietnam, especially in teaching the genre to young people, performing publicly, increasing audience engagement, and generally raising the profile of the genre. By the 1950s the genre had become associated with disrepute (opium, girl serve wine and misunderstanding about Ca Trù singers). From the late 1950s to the late 1980s, Ca Trù performances were rare, and a lot of the musical knowledge was lost. Despite renewed public interest and a spate of recent revitalization initiatives, there are still few regular performance contexts. The few remaining competent Ca Trù musicians are mostly very elderly. In the countryside, the ceremonial part of the Ca Trù repertoire, Hat Cua Dinh, was still cherished for festivals and ancestral worshop ceremonies.
